What Drives the Debate Over the UK’s Zero Emissions Vehicle Mandate?

At the heart of the current policy debate lies a tension between regulatory ambition and industrial feasibility. The UK’s Zero Emissions Vehicle (ZEV) mandate, which compels automakers to sell a rising proportion of electric vehicles (EVs) each year—culminating in an 80% target by 2030—has become a flashpoint for competing interests. On one side, policymakers and environmental advocates argue that aggressive targets are essential to decarbonize transport and meet climate commitments. On the other, automakers and some industry analysts warn that the mandated pace outstrips both consumer demand and the sector’s economic resilience, risking unintended consequences for jobs, investment, and the broader supply chain.

The evidence suggests that the core mechanism at stake is not simply a matter of setting targets, but of calibrating the rate of technological and market transformation. The mandate’s structure—allowing compliance through credit trading or emissions reductions from combustion fleets—offers some flexibility, but the looming threat of substantial fines (£12,000 per excess vehicle) introduces a punitive dimension that may distort pricing strategies and investment decisions. The government’s reported willingness to soften the 2030 target from 80% to 50% EV sales reflects, at least in part, an implicit acknowledgment of these structural constraints.

How Do Industry Pressures and Policy Objectives Collide?

The automotive sector’s reaction to the ZEV mandate has not been monolithic. While some manufacturers, such as Renault, advocate for clear and ambitious regulatory frameworks to provide investment certainty and accelerate the transition, others—particularly those with significant legacy combustion engine operations—have lobbied for a more gradual ramp-up. The divergence is not merely rhetorical. Volkswagen’s suggestion that it may raise internal combustion engine (ICE) vehicle prices to offset EV losses, and Stellantis’s warning of possible contraction in UK operations, point to a deeper economic calculus: the risk of stranded assets, margin compression, and market share volatility.

This dynamic is further complicated by the practice of discounting EVs to stimulate demand, a strategy that, according to several industry voices, is unsustainable in the medium term. The House of Commons’ Business and Trade Committee’s warning that the mandate “poses significant risks” to domestic automotive production underscores a broader concern: that regulatory overreach could undermine the very industrial base it seeks to green. Yet, this interpretation remains contested. Proponents of the mandate argue that policy instability—rather than ambition per se—poses the greater threat to investment and innovation.

What Are the Second-Order Consequences for Consumers and the Broader Economy?

Beyond the immediate interests of manufacturers and policymakers, the ZEV mandate’s trajectory carries implications for consumers and the wider economic landscape that are often overlooked. Should automakers respond to compliance pressures by raising ICE vehicle prices or curtailing model availability, the result could be a regressive impact on lower-income households, for whom EVs remain relatively expensive despite recent price declines. Furthermore, the potential for market fragmentation—where some brands reduce their UK footprint or prioritize other regions—could erode consumer choice and diminish the UK’s attractiveness as an automotive hub.

The debate also exposes a less visible, but no less significant, risk: that of policy-induced volatility. As industry groups such as ChargeUK and Transport and Environment have argued, frequent changes to regulatory targets may deter long-term investment in both vehicle manufacturing and charging infrastructure. This instability, rather than the stringency of any single target, could ultimately “bring Britain’s reputation as a market worth investing in into disrepute,” as one stakeholder put it. The practical significance of this claim is not easily dismissed; capital allocation decisions in the automotive sector are inherently global and highly sensitive to perceived regulatory risk.

Where Do the Lines of Reasoning Diverge—and Which Holds Greater Validity?

The crux of the disagreement is whether the primary bottleneck to EV adoption is supply-driven (industry capacity, cost structures, and technological readiness) or demand-driven (consumer willingness, infrastructure availability, and affordability). While the government’s apparent readiness to relax the 2030 target signals a tilt toward the supply-side argument, this move is not without its critics. Advocates for maintaining or even tightening the mandate contend that only ambitious, stable targets can overcome inertia and catalyze the necessary investments in infrastructure and innovation.

Methodologically, the available data on EV uptake and consumer sentiment is subject to rapid change and regional variation, limiting the predictive power of any single forecast. However, the weight of evidence currently favors the view that a precipitous ramp-up, absent corresponding demand-side incentives and infrastructure build-out, risks backlash and underperformance. This does not mean that ambition should be abandoned, but rather that the sequencing and coherence of policy instruments must be carefully managed.
